The average credit card balance is now more than $6,000, the highest in 10 years, a new report by TransUnion found.

Total credit card debt also reached a $1.08 trillion record in the latest quarter, the Federal Reserve Bank of New York reported Tuesday.

Amid persistent inflation, consumers are struggling to afford their everyday expenses, TransUnion's Charlie Wise says. "They're trying to keep the house of cards from collapsing."
